Marketing CopyTomaso Antonio Vitali (1663-1745) became violinist of the d’Este Court Orchestra in Modena at the young age of twelve. As a composer he is mostly remembered as the creator of the Chaconne for violin and continuo. Since the composer’s autograph was lost, the work was ?rst published and edited by Ferdinand David from a copyist manuscript in 1867. The Chaconne has also been arranged for violin and organ, violin and string quartet and orchestra with solo violin. It has become an integral part of violin recital programs, known as an ideal opening work. This unique and practical performance edition includes bowings and fingerings by Endre Grant, one of Jascha Heifetz’ most acclaimed protégés.
